4 out of 5 stars Love is the LAW.......2006-03-15

Calling the Patti Smith Group's "Because the Night" the best single of the 80s is a little like saying "We Built This City" is the best single of the 90s or "Yesterday" is the best signle of the 70s. It came out in '75. Still, it IS awesome, and there are a few other selections here that are neccessary 80s tunes. Romeo Void, Furs, Bunnymen. And props for including the Suburbs "Love is the Law": A true New Wave classic. If you approach the 80s from a college radio (and not an MTV) type place, the Sedated series might just be for you. 5 out of 5 stars Sublime.......2005-03-26

Patti Smith's Because the Night (written for her by Bruce Springsteen) is simply the best single of the 80's, hands down. So you know that an 80's compilation that includes it is going to be great. And this one is great. You also get the best of Exene and X -- Los Angeles -- as well as Wall of Voodoo's mindblowing cover of Johnny Cash's cover of the Carter Family's Ring of Fire. Wow. The Kinks making a comeback in the 80's with Superman (wouldn't it be cool if Laurie Anderson's O Superman was on this volume instead of on Vol. 3 ... but then that volume is also fabulous so go ahead and get it too) The English Beat doing I Confess ... Chili Peppers' proto-whiteboy-hiphop Fight Like a Brave ... Ramones, David Bowie, what more do you want? This is a CD to listen to again and again. I've been collecting the Rhino New Wave Hits series, which is good, but after stumbling across the Sedated series I have to say it's superior. Smart people put these compilations together.

      4 out of 5 stars Great introduction to some forgotten bands.......2006-05-31

      Son of Pure Rock was a 1988 compilation of some lesser known hard rock and hair metal acts. It was sponsored by L.A. radio station KNAC.

      The album has some interesting moments. The Guy Mann Dude track is nice if you like guitar wizardry, Crisis was a better than average melodic rock band with female vocals, and Fighter was a Christian AOR band with dual lead vocals.

      While the bands featured on Son of Pure Rock might not be up to par with the better known metal groups of that era, the album serves as a good introduction to some bands you otherwise might not have encountered. Of the ten bands featured on the album, only Guy Mann Dude and Fighter went on to release additional material, though Angora vocalist John Corabi briefly fronted Motley Crue.
